Fast horse - Hayauma
〘noun〙① A horse ridden by a Hayauchi messenger. A horse for a courier. Also, a courier riding on that horse. ※Heike (early 13th century) 5 "He sent a fast horse to Fukuhara to tell them." ② A horse that runs fast. A horse that runs well. A swift horse. ※Heichu (around 965) 34 "Because this man was a stealthy man, he would live with the thought of being his wife, even though he didn't think he was his wife."

Hayama [Fast horse]

〘Noun〙① = Hayauma (fast horse) [Collected Words (around 1797)] ② God of cattle and horses. Also, the horse race (kurabeuma) held at the festival of that god. In Kagoshima Prefecture.
